    Hiroshi Hirata (1937–2021) was a legendary Japanese manga artist and a pioneer of the gekiga (dramatic pictures) movement, celebrated for his uncompromising historical epics. His work focused almost exclusively on the Sengoku period, meticulously depicting the samurai code, themes of loyalty, honor, and the brutality of life among common warriors.

    His most acclaimed manga, such as Satsuma Gishiden (The Saga of the Loyal Retainers of Satsuma) and Kubidai Hikiukenin (The Head Taker), are known for their incredibly detailed, dynamic artwork. Hirata’s signature style features powerful brushwork, stark black-and-white visuals, and a masterful use of calligraphy, cementing his status as one of the greatest artists of historical Japanese fiction.
